Skill: update
Purpose: Produce a single Update Report at artifacts/00-updates/update-YYYY-MM-DD-NN.md summarising what changed in the Elicitation Document and downstream artefacts since the previous Update Report, and recommending which downstream skills to re-run to bring the pipeline back to a consistent state. The skill is the framework's update coordinator — it runs after /elicit has been re-run with new inputs and APPROVED, compares the current pipeline state against the element snapshot embedded in the previous Update Report (if any), and writes a fresh dated report. The skill is diagnostic, not generative: it mints no IDs, modifies no upstream artefact, never invokes another skill, and has no APPROVED gate of its own. Re-runs always produce a new dated file; prior reports persist for audit. The skill is forward-compatible with Component 3 (the Amendment Protocol): Section 3.5 of the Update Report template is a placeholder that becomes a populated table once AM-### amendment proposals exist.

Step 2 — Snapshot the current pipeline state
Walk every artefact in the pipeline and build current_snapshot — a mapping id → {type, status, content-hash, last-modified-by} for every first-class element.
For each element in the pipeline:
| Source artefact | Elements to extract |
|---|---|
elicitation-document.md |
SH-### (§3), BUC-### (§3), FR-### / NFR-### / CON-### (§5), AC-FR-###-NN / AC-NFR-###-NN (§6), ASMP-### / RSK-### (§7), OQ-### (§7) |
artifacts/02-epics/epic-*.md |
EP-### (frontmatter status, body content) |
artifacts/03-user-stories/story-*.md |
US-### (frontmatter status, body content) |
artifacts/04-srs/srs.md |
The SRS itself as one element (id = SRS, status = frontmatter status, content-hash = sha256 of body); does NOT re-extract FR/NFR/CON/AC (those are in elicit doc) |
artifacts/05-test-concept/test-case-*.md |
TC-### (frontmatter status) |
artifacts/07-implementation-tasks/task-*.md |
TASK-### (frontmatter status) |
For each element compute:
- id: canonical identifier
- type: SH / BUC / FR / NFR / CON / AC / ASMP / RSK / OQ / EP / US / SRS / TC / TASK
- status: the value present in the element's frontmatter or status line — never reinterpreted (Pending / Accepted / Rejected / Open / Resolved / Validated / Invalidated / Mitigated / Closed depending on element type)
- content-hash: sha256 of the element's normalised body content. Normalisation rules: strip leading/trailing whitespace; collapse internal whitespace runs (spaces + tabs + newlines) to single spaces; preserve case; the hash is computed on the original normalised content (do not lowercase for hashing). Output as lowercase hex digest, 64 chars.
- last-modified-by: for elements minted/refined by
/elicit: the filename ininputs/manifest.mdwhose most recent processing line mentions this element ID. For elements minted by downstream skills (TCs, TASKs, EPs, USs, SRS): the literal string"skill-generated".
current_snapshot is the canonical state record for this run.
Step 3 — Compute the delta
Compare current_snapshot against prev_snapshot.
If prev_snapshot is None (first run): every element is reported as "baseline" — none of the categories below apply; Sections 3.1 through 3.4 of the report show "(none — first run)". Section 3.5 shows the Component-3 placeholder text. Continue to Step 4 with an empty delta (Step 4 will recommend only /trace).
Otherwise apply these classification rules to each element ID across the union of prev_snapshot and current_snapshot:

The anomalous content change category is the Component-3 forward-compatibility hook. Component 1 does not have an amendment-proposal mechanism, so for each anomaly the skill records a Note in Section 3.5 of the report:
Note: TASK-### shows content-hash drift on Accepted element. Component 3 (Amendment Protocol) is required to handle this case properly. Manual reconciliation required: review the element, decide whether to flip status back to Pending (allowing refinement) or to keep the Accepted version (treating the input change as out-of-scope).
When Component 3 ships, the anomaly path is replaced by AM-### amendment proposals raised inside /elicit itself; /update just surfaces them in 3.5 as a table.
Step 4 — Determine downstream re-run recommendations
Apply the published heuristic table to the delta. Every recommendation carries its triggering rationale (the specific element IDs that caused it) — this rationale renders in Section 4 of the report.
| Recommend | Triggered when |
|---|---|
/create-epics |
The delta contains at least one new FR or NFR; OR any FR or NFR is in Pending refined and its Business Use Case field changed (the Business Use Case field is detectable by comparing the relevant sub-string of the element body) |
/create-stories |
The delta contains a new FR; OR a refined Pending FR whose parent-fr is referenced by an existing Story; OR a refined AC under an FR that has a Story |
/create-srs |
The delta contains any element that is now Accepted-and-in-scope (per the partial-by-Epic rule) that was not in the current SRS body. Caveat (Component 1): since the SRS baselining protocol is not yet shipped, the recommendation includes the text "Manual workaround until Component 2: Reject the Accepted SRS, then re-run /create-srs to publish a new version." |
/create-tests |
/create-srs was recommended (above); OR any new AC was minted; OR any refined AC under an existing TC's parent-ac |
/create-tasks |
A new Story is now Accepted under an Accepted Epic; OR a Task's parent-ac is in the delta |
/trace |
Always — to verify chain integrity after the recommended cascade completes |
If no triggers fire other than /trace: Section 4 of the report contains only the /trace recommendation with the note "No upstream changes recommend a downstream re-run; /trace is recommended only to confirm chain integrity."
The skill never invokes any of these — it only recommends.
